What did Luna Lovegood do after Hogwarts?

While the books don't explicitly state what Luna Lovegood did after Hogwarts, J.K. Rowling has shared some insights through interviews and the Pottermore website. Here's what we know:

* Wrote for The Quibbler: Luna continued her work with her father, Xenophilius Lovegood, at *The Quibbler*. It's likely she became a prominent writer and editor, continuing to publish interesting and sometimes eccentric articles about magical creatures and phenomena.

* Worked with the Ministry: J.K. Rowling has mentioned that Luna eventually worked for the Ministry of Magic, likely in the Department of Magical Creatures. This fits her passion for the fantastical and her dedication to understanding and protecting magical beings.

* Married Rolf Scamander: Luna married Rolf Scamander, grandson of Newt Scamander, the famous Magizoologist. They had twin sons, Lorcan and Lysander.

* Happy and content: Rowling has stated that Luna found happiness and fulfillment in her life after Hogwarts. She was described as living a quiet and peaceful life with Rolf and their family, continuing to be a kind and eccentric individual.
